Sagrada Família rumored to be released as first 12,000-piece LEGO set

A hot new rumor has LEGO fans and architecture aficionados equally excited: Brick Fanatics reports that the long-anticipated 12,000-piece LEGO Architecture set would feature Barcelona's famously unfinished Sagrada Família cathedral design.
The outlet bases its prediction on an Instagram post by Brick Tap, which states a release date of July 1st, 2026, for the rumored 21065 Sagrada Familia set. At 12,060 pieces, it would make it the largest LEGO set by piece count. Brick Tap's leak reports the price to be $600 USD.
View this post on Instagram A post shared by a.clay.brick (@a.clay.brick)The original Antoni Gaudí landmark is indeed making big strides toward eventual completion, more than 140 years after construction began in 1882. Last month, the final piece of its massive central Tower of Jesus Christ was put in place, making it the world's tallest church and the tallest building in Barcelona at 566 feet.
